I had to satisfy my own curiosity so I bought another Wolvie/Cap comic pack off of HTS and compared the old one I have to the new one. There is no difference in the figures, but there are minor differences in the packaging. The Marvel Universe logo now has a blue line in between Marvel and Universe instead of white, the ages 4 and up no longer has a black background, and on the back the advertisement for Spider-Man/Sentry is now Thanos/Adam Warlock. There's no other difference as far as I can tell. So this new pack is for the extreme completionist collectors who must have them all.

trebleshot 06-05-2013 06:18 AM

Marvel changing the MU logo would not automatically make Hasbro re-do the packaging and re-release older figure to just to reflect the change. More likely, what's happened is Hasbro found out that they needed to make additional batces of comic packs and decided to update the packaging slightly (especially if they already had to change the MU logo).

And while it may seem kind of pointless to most of us, it is a way to prove that those "new" comic packs are from a new factory run and not simply leftover stock from the last run of them.
